About the job
In this role, you will:
- Conduct thorough internal theft investigations while strictly following company policies, procedures, and guidance from Asset Protection leadership.
- Utilize technology, reporting, and surveillance techniques to identify and analyze theft trends.
- Foster a culture of theft prevention by executing action plans from Asset Protection leadership aimed at minimizing shortages through improved processes and standards.
- Identify, escalate, and support internal theft investigations as directed by Asset Protection leadership.
- Gather intelligence and communicate critical issues to avert theft.
- Effectively utilize video systems to monitor theft activities and aid in internal investigations.
- Respond to incidents and ensure proper documentation is submitted in line with Asset Protection standards.
